Basic facts about this digital color

The digital color #93C0C7 is classified in the Register under the Cyan Color Family, with Mild Saturation and Very Light brightness. Its exact recipe is rgb(147, 192, 199) — 57.6% red, 75.3% green, 78% blue — and for print it converts to CMYK 20 / 3 / 0 / 22.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

#93C0C7 presents itself as a mildly saturated aqua cyan — one that floats near the light end of the scale. It is a natural fit for clean interfaces where content needs room to breathe. In The Official Register of Color Names it is practically indistinguishable from Cyan Opaque (#92C7C7). Nearby in the Register you will also find Escape (#9EC0CA) and Half Kumutoto (#9CC8CA).

The recipe behind #93C0C7 is rgb(147, 192, 199), with blue as the dominant ingredient. If you plan to put text on a #93C0C7 background, choose black — the contrast ratio is 10.6:1 (passing WCAG AAA), while white manages only 2.0:1. #93C0C7 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
